The 3 months correlation between Blackrock and Aberdeen is -0.54.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Blackrock Muni Intermediate and Aberdeen Global IF in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Aberdeen Global IF and Blackrock Muni is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Blackrock Muni Intermediate are associated (or correlated) with Aberdeen Global.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Aberdeen Global IF has no effect on the direction of Blackrock Muni i.e., Blackrock Muni and Aberdeen Global go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Blackrock Muni and Aberdeen Global
The main advantage of trading using opposite Blackrock Muni and Aberdeen Global posit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Blackrock Muni position performs unexpectedly, Aberdeen Global can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
